(Alejandrina) Mireya Luis Hernández

B. 1967-08-25, Camagüey, Cuba
Volleyball (3 gold)
1992 1996 2000 HP
Women's Team gold gold gold 19200
19200

Member of the Cuban Volleyball team that won gold at Barcelona, Atlanta and Sydney.
Named by some the greatest volleyball player of the 20th century, she would also have competed in 1984 and 1988, but Cuba boycotted both those games.
